Questão Minha velha mãe no Ubuntu gnome perder arquivos .desktop


Eu moro longe da minha mãe. Quando seu laptop antigo no Windows XP morreu, eu o substituí por um minicomputador com o Ubuntu gnome (14.04) que eu administrei remotamente (ssh, x11vnc e rsync para backups). Como usuários antigos do windows xp, ela possui muitos ícones em sua área de trabalho. Eu criei alguns lançadores (firefox.desktop, thunderbird.desktop, Word.desktop (para o escritor de escritório libre)).

Regularmente, ela me liga porque um desses lançadores desapareceu. Cada vez que encontro o lançador perdido na pasta de lixo. Provavelmente um erro da minha mãe.

Como você protegeria esses lançadores enquanto deixava a permissão de gravação na pasta Desktop? Devo escrever um cron para monitorar esses erros?

Uma ideia é colocar o sticky bit na pasta desktop e mudar o dono da pasta e dos arquivos .desktop para root. Existem efeitos colaterais desagradáveis ​​a serem esperados?


0


origem


Pode não ser a resposta que você está procurando, mas talvez você possa ensiná-la a restaurar o arquivo do lixo? - gronostaj
Sim, mas ela tem 80 anos e já tem dificuldades com o thunderbird. Eu tento ensiná-la a ver fotos, mas muitas vezes ela se perde. - Jean-Francois Bocquet


Respostas:


chmod não é um assistente: se houver permissões de gravação para o diretório, então, mesmo chmod 000 não salvará da exclusão. Você pode ajudar chattr +i no arquivo. Então, mesmo a raiz não poderá excluir o arquivo até remover este atributo (chattr -i).


0



Excelente! Eu nunca tinha ouvido falar sobre esse chattr. A única desvantagem é que o gnome desenha uma pequena trava no ícone. Você sabe como evitar esse bloqueio? - Jean-Francois Bocquet
e isso é um problema tão grande? tente explicar para sua mãe, para não prestar atenção (embora possa ser difícil - eu mesmo sei) - Alex_Krug